Is a relationship supposed to be exhausting?

Is a relationship supposed to be exhausting?

Every couple is prone to the occasional disagreement from time to time. But if you’re constantly feeling stressed any time you think about your partner, or if you feel physically exhausted from spending time with them, it’s possible that your relationship is seriously impacting your mental health.

Can love be exhausting?

Your new love life may consume your energy, focus, and time to the point where everything else going on in your life may feel like a rude intrusion. You are under the influence of hormones that are making you feel, all at once, euphoric, endangered, and exhausted.

Is your relationship exhausting you emotionally?

Your relationship may be exhausting you emotionally if you’re the only one constantly making sacrifices to ensure your partner’s needs are being met. If you experience anxiety, fatigue, or depression when you’re around your partner, it may be time to reach out to a licensed mental health professional or relationship counselor.
